Well, I received a bunch of Joytech 510 Cartomizers from Cignot (Yes I paid for them). These are something *new*.
These are initial impressions, and I'll do a full video review when I have more time on them.
First off, let me say that I do not like Cartomizers. The KR808 types burn too hot for me, and seriously disrupt the flavor of the juices I like. So those kits are available to me, but are rarely used. Also, played with a CE2 which I did not like.
Personally, I like the 510 atomizer, with cartridges, and various cart mods. And vaping is something that happens all the time in my life... constant.
The new cartos vape like a 510 atty. I kid you not. Just like a 510 atomizer.
The main difference is vapor consistency and juice capacity. The cartomizers hold close to 1ml, and vape strong until the dreaded "dry hit".
My initial impression is that these are truly "ready for prime time". I've only emptied one of these 4 times, but it has accepted four refills without a reduction in quality.
In case of overfill, I've also found out that you can use a syringe to pull out the excess juice...
So what are the negatives?
Well, like the eGoMega cartomizers, there is a fill port that is only accessible by disassembling the mouthpiece, inserting a syringe to break a seal on the fill port, and then filling with 1ml of juice. (I've gone with 4/5ths of a ML just to avoid over filling)
That is about what I can tell you. First impression... massive success.
